How a business was started out of adversity
My father was diagnosed with cancer and given 6 months to live. As frightening as this diagnosis was, he walked away from the advice of his doctor in search of other answers. In spite of being devastated and overwhelmed with uncertainty, rather than focusing on his fears, he resisted the temptation and shifted his focus more on the possibilities for a more positive outcome. As he researched the globe it soon became apparent that certain dietary practices and lifestyle changes could provide therapeutic benefits. Benefits that might help extend his life. Because sprouts have the highest concentration of nutrients, more than at any other stage in a plant’s life, this made sprouts an excellent addition to his diet. They were nutrient-dense, quick, easy, and convenient to add to almost any meal. However my Dad found that most supermarkets had wilted, half spoiled sprouts that were imported from the US.
What he was looking for, and needed, was something that was robust, alive, safe and at its prime in terms of nutrients.
“Sprouts are baby plants in their prime. At this stage of their growth, they have a greater concentration of proteins, vitamins, minerals, enzymes, RNA, DNA, bio-flavinoids, and T-cells than at any other point in the plant’s life, even when compared with the mature vegetable”.
So, in 1982 we started our Sprout family business and began growing sprouts in Alberta for the Canadian market. The facility quickly grew as we took over the market with a superior product.
Since then we’ve grown and evolved.
From the beginning we’ve resisted using anything that would compromise the integrity of our sprouts, this means we avoided all preservatives, chemicals, and sanitizers.
